Even if an athlete gets a medical hardship waiver, he or she needs to have time left on their five-year clock (10-semester/15-quarter clock in Divisions II and III) to use that season. The injury must have occurred in the first half of the season and the player must have competed in less than 30% of the competition. Then there are the academic redshirts, whose high school transcript does not meet the colleges academic eligibility requirements, and the medical redshirt, a player who suffered a season-ending injury while appearing in less than 30 percent of the teams games.
